Jey Uso says he plans to up his game every week in the leadup to WrestleMania.
At the 2025 Royal Rumble last weekend, Jey Uso would win the men's Rumble match earning himself a main event match at WrestleMania, truly embodying his nickname. Uso is currently riding an incredible wave of momentum on the Road To WrestleMania, and many fans question if Uso can sustain it.
While speaking to Daniel Cormier on his YouTube channel, Jey Uso was asked how he plans to keep his level of momentum going through to WrestleMania 41.
“Same way I’ve been doing it. Every week, I lock in, Uce. Every single Monday Night Raw or Friday Night SmackDown, I lock in that night. I don’t go like, ‘I’m gonna save that for next week.’ I give it all that night, and then I’ll figure out next week. Then I’ll have to up my game that week. So I’m gonna do that all the way to WrestleMania, Uce. I’m on my high horse now, Uce. I punched my ticket to WrestleMania. Half the stress is off me now. It’s time to have fun, but also stay in the gym, be careful when I’m wrestling. Stay away from Waffle House kind of. Damn, I know they got Waffle House in Cleveland, Ohio. I’m like, damn."
On Friday's edition of SmackDown, Jey would tease choosing Cody Rhodes as his opponent for WrestleMania 41, before competing in a tag team match. You can read the full results from Friday's edition of SmackDown here.
